LeGSB & LGA Information Standards in Public Services forum

Events - Public

Starting 25 Sep 2014 - 10:30 through to 25 Sep 2014 - 17:00

This event will bring together these stakeholders and the wider information management community to:

- Understand why this is so important
- Share what is working and the lessons that can be learnt.
- Agree common barriers and propose solutions.
- Explore tools and techniques such as LG Inform Plus
- Engage with colleagues across central and local government, the NHS and other relevant agencies

LeGSB supports work on information standards for several Government Departments and Local Authorities including on welfare reform, troubled families, planning, smart cities and community assets.

The current registered audience of approximately 35 people are largely all working in this area on projects within local public service organisations, running cross sector initiatives or activities within Government departments or programmes. Representatives from 14 councils are attending plus DCLG, DWP, the Health & Social Care Information Centre, Dept for Education and Cabinet Office.
